Overview

Intentionally sized at 180 students, relationships are at the core of the CRMS experience. The curriculum is a perfect blend of traditional college-prep academics infused with project-based learning and teaching excellence -- your teachers will know you, engage you, and inspire you to think in ways you haven’t before. Learning at CRMS also means experiencing outdoor adventure through trips (four trips per year), mountain sports (climbing, skiing, biking and kayaking) and service learning programs (domestic and international). Students at CRMS learn by doing and creativity is celebrated throughout the program including an unrivaled art offerings (blacksmithing, glassblowing, silversmithing, ceramics, and graphic design) and a school-wide passion for music production and performance. Frequently Ask Questions about Colorado Rocky Mountain School

01.
Tell me a bit about Colorado Rocky Mountain School.
Colorado Rocky Mountain School is Co-ed private boarding school located in Denver, Colorado, US. It was founded 1953 , and currently has about 180 students, 15.00% of whom are international students.

For more official information, please visit http://www.crms.org.
02.
Does Colorado Rocky Mountain School have rigorous academic requirements?
Colorado Rocky Mountain School is offering 5 AP courses.

In recent years, 51 of their students score 4 and 5 in AP exams.

Colorado Rocky Mountain School also have 62% of faculties whose degrees are master and above.

Where is Colorado Rocky Mountain School located?
Colorado Rocky Mountain School is located in the State of Colorado of USA. The closest major city is Denver, which is about 128 miles away from school. Most families can choose Denver International Airport to travel in and out of school.
